Introduction: An administrative platform, SAP Basis serves as the operating system for ABAP and SAP applications. It serves as the framework for the entire SAP landscape and makes sure that every system is performing to its full potential. While BASIS stands for Business Application Software Integrated Solution, SAP stands for Systems, Applications & Products in Data Processing. Maintenance, system upgrades, the configuration of system jobs, the observation and analysis of system logs, and other administrative responsibilities take place by basis administrators. The management and administration of SAP systems come under the responsibility of an SAP Basis Administrator. Actually, these needs are in charge of the system runtime environment, overseeing system collaboration, planning and deploying system upgrades, addressing user requests, looking into performance issues (including the network, databases, or operating systems), backups, and the architecture. The SAP Basis Administrator also stays current on industry trends, offering solutions that are appropriate for the contemporary business and operational environment. The Objective of SAP Basis: The main goal of SAP BASIS is to guarantee the stability and secure operation of SAP systems. Additionally, it addresses SAP BASIS production and non-production circumstances. It also covers other elements like performance evaluation, upgrades, patch installation, and more. It also emphasizes routine system monitoring and troubleshooting. Moreover, a committed SAP Basis staff is necessary for ongoing, daily activity. When is the Need for SAP Basis Teams in Organizations? At the onset of different professional activities. After the installation and maintenance of different systems at the company by different functional consultants of individual systems. The CRM consultant becomes in charge of the SAP CRM system. However, with time, Basis-related tasks became even more complex and time-consuming, wasting time for consultants that can be useful in other areas as well. Hence, now it was needful to appoint a person to deal exclusively with Basis problems of prior importance. Additionally, the person responsible for SAP Basis needs to possess a broad range of skills related to operating systems (Windows and Linux), databases (such as Oracle, MaxDB, and HANA Database), and network services in addition to knowledge of SAP systems directly. Moving to a later stage, the organization expansion requires an entire SAP Basis team. Thus, making a usual process for all organizations today.
